### Step 6: Warm-up configuration

To reduce cold starts on the Duskmere handlers, the deploy script schedules a pinger that invokes each function every four minutes. Reviewer checklist: confirm `WARMUP_CONCURRENCY=2` and `WARMUP_TIMEOUT_MS=900` in `handlers.env`, and verify the pinger is excluded from billing metrics via the `internal` tag. The pinger authenticates against the invocation gateway, so its credential must be present in the same file. Add it on the line below:

secret setting of bawip-hahip: ARCHIVE_KEY3=709

## Ownership

The clock-skew monitor for the Quarrylight build farm lives in this repo. Build agents occasionally drift more than the 250ms tolerance, which breaks artifact timestamp ordering and causes the Slatebird scheduler to mark runs as flaky. If support sees skew alerts, first check the NTP sidecar logs, then escalate rather than restarting agents manually — restarts mask the drift without fixing it. Questions about the monitor, its thresholds, or the escalation path go to the component owner listed below.

account owner for kagag-yahap: Novath Quenok

The baseline records known findings so that only newly introduced issues fail CI; updates require a two-reviewer approval recorded in the request metadata. As discussed at last week's sync, all reads and writes now require service-level authentication rather than per-user tokens, and unauthenticated requests return a 401 without a body. Requests should authenticate with the key below.

gateway credential: kto23_LX9A4ys6i4nzHtpOLNLodKK